May 20-23, 17th ACM Web Science Conference 2025 Maintaining a Human-Centric Web in the Era of Generative AI

Maintaining a Human-Centric Web in the Era of Generative AI
Join us at Rutgers University, New Brunswick, New Jersey, USA
Web Science is an interdisciplinary field dedicated to understanding the complex and multiple impacts of the Web on society and vice versa. The discipline is well situated to address pressing issues of our time by incorporating various scientific approaches. We welcome quantitative, qualitative and mixed methods research, including techniques from the social sciences and computer science. In addition, we are interested in work exploring Web-based data collection and research ethics. We also encourage studies that combine analyses of Web data and other types of data (e.g., from surveys or interviews) and help better understand user behavior online and offline.
